Definition:

Needful (adjective): Referring to something that is necessary or required; essential for a particular purpose or situation.

Etymology:

Needful originates from the combination of the word “need,” which comes from the Old English “nēod” (meaning necessity or to force, compel), and the suffix “-ful,” which means full of or characterized by. Thus, it conveys the sense of being full of need or necessity.

Pronunciation:

Needful is pronounced as /ˈniːd.fəl/ in phonetic notation.
